Signs of Food Allergies
Signs of food sensitivity or intolerance typically occur within hours to days after eating a specific type of food. Food allergies may show up immediately or within minutes to hours of eating. The signs and symptoms vary depending on the food allergy as well as the individual.
- Skin rash or hives
- Tingly or itchy feeling inside the mouth
- Swelling of lips, tongue, throat, and face
- Stomach cramps or pain
- Diarrhea or flatulence
- Indigestion or gas
- Nausea or vomiting
- Difficulty swallowing or breathing
- Dizziness or fainting

What is the difference between food allergy vs. intolerance vs. sensitivity?
When someone with a food allergy eats something they’re allergic to, their body creates an immune response because it views that food as harmful. This response can lead to life-threatening symptoms like low blood pressure, difficulty breathing, and anaphylaxis.
Food intolerance is the inability to digest and process certain foods. Unlike allergies, food intolerances involve the digestive system and aren’t caused by an immune response. The most common symptoms of food intolerance include abdominal pain, gas, or diarrhea.
Food sensitivities are symptoms not related to intolerances or food allergies that people experience after eating certain foods. When someone eats a food they’re sensitive to, they can experience an immune response that causes non-life-threatening symptoms like joint pain, rash, fatigue, stomach pain, and brain fog.
